Our Mission

Our mission is to solve the most important and fundamental challenges in AI and Robotics to enable future generations of intelligent machines that will help us all live better lives.

The AI Institute is building an environment that fosters the kind of blue-sky thinking found in academic labs and quickly drives it to practice through development discipline and resources more common to top-tier industry teams

As a Robot Data Collection Engineer, you will be working with Researchers, Engineers and Technicians to conduct accurate and efficient data collection across multiple research programs.

You will play a crucial role in ensuring the successful execution of skills and behaviors on robotic hardware and also organizing data generated.

This position requires a combination of technical skills, attention to detail, and a proactive approach to problem-solving.

Responsibilities

  • Utilize specialized software, prebuilt programs and tools to collect high quality data generated by robots during operation.
  • Execute closed and open-loop policies on robotic hardware according to predefined plans. Monitor and record execution outcomes using comprehensive logs to facilitate analysis and evaluation.
  • Collaborate with the development team to identify and address any issues that may arise during hardware verification.
  • Maintain a proactive approach to detect significant performance deterioration during execution and promptly notify the team.
  • Work with a variety of robotic platforms, including Boston Dynamics Spot, Kuka LBR iiwa robot, and the Franka Emika FR3 robot arm.

Requirements

  • BS / MS in computer science, robotics, or a related technical field.
  • Experience with programming languages such as Python or C++.
  • Proficiency with Linux operating systems, including command-line interfaces and shell scripting.
  • Experience configuring and troubleshooting networking, software and hardware issues.
  • Excellent communication skills to effectively collaborate with the development team and report findings.

Bonus

  • Familiarity with ROS, docker containers, Motion Capture Systems
  • Familiarity with Reinforcement Learning, Policy training
  • Familiarity with CAD and 3D printing
  • Familiarity with data analysis tools and techniques, such as statistical analysis, machine learning, and data visualization.
